Easy Texas Toast Sloppy Joes for a Comforting Dinner

This Texas Toast Sloppy Joe recipe takes the classic sloppy joe and transforms it into something even more delicious and satisfying. Instead of the typical soft hamburger buns, the rich and savory beef filling is served on thick slices of Texas toast, which are golden and buttery. Each bite offers a wonderful combination of textures and flavors—the crispy crunch of garlic-infused toasted bread paired with the hearty, saucy meat mixture, all topped with a generous layer of melted cheddar cheese. This dish elevates traditional comfort food by adding a flavorful and indulgent twist that will delight anyone who tries it.

To make the filling, ground beef is browned along with chopped onions and bell peppers, cooking until the vegetables are tender and the beef is nicely caramelized. Then, garlic, ketchup, tomato paste, brown sugar, Worcestershire sauce, and a blend of spices are added to the pan. This combination creates a tangy, slightly sweet sauce that perfectly coats every piece of beef, making the flavors bold yet balanced. The sauce simmers gently to develop depth and richness, resulting in a thick, hearty mixture that is both comforting and satisfying.

While the beef filling simmers, frozen slices of Texas toast are brushed generously with garlic butter. They are then baked in the oven until they become crispy and golden brown, with a rich buttery aroma that fills the kitchen. When the beef mixture is ready, it is spooned generously over the toasted bread. Then, a generous handful of shredded cheddar cheese is sprinkled on top. The toast is placed back in the oven for just a few minutes, allowing the cheese to melt into a bubbly, gooey topping that ties all the flavors together beautifully.
